Unchecked AI Use Risks Undermining Scientific Integrity
Artificial intelligence is transforming research practices across disciplines. Yet, without proper oversight, its unchecked use threatens to compromise the scientific process itself. Experts have raised concerns that current incentive systems in academia may encourage researchers to deploy AI tools in ways that undermine rigorous inquiry.
Concerns from European Science Leaders
On 29 April, the European Parliament’s Panel for the Future of Science and Technology held a debate on AI’s role in science. Leading academics emphasized the need for clear governance structures to guide AI use and ensure it supports, rather than diminishes, research quality.
They warned that career reward systems often prioritize rapid outputs, inadvertently incentivizing superficial or improperly validated AI-generated results. This approach risks eroding trust in scientific findings and weakening the foundational principles of research.
Why Governance Matters
- AI-generated data and analyses require validation frameworks to confirm accuracy and reproducibility.
- Transparent reporting on AI methods is essential to allow peer review and verification.
- Institutions must establish policies balancing innovation with ethical and methodological standards.
Without these measures, AI’s contribution to science may be compromised by misuse or overreliance. Strengthening governance can safeguard research integrity and help integrate AI as a reliable tool.
Practical Steps for Researchers
- Critically assess AI tools before integrating them into workflows. Understand their limitations and potential biases.
- Document AI methodologies clearly in publications and data sets.
- Advocate for institutional guidelines that promote responsible AI use.
Adopting these practices contributes to a research culture that values quality over quantity and ensures AI enhances rather than undermines scientific discovery.
